1. The Historical Context of Accounting Tests for Employment



Accounting tests for employment have evolved significantly since their inception. Initially, these tests primarily focused on basic bookkeeping skills and mathematical proficiency. Early versions often lacked standardization and lacked validity in predicting on-the-job performance. As accounting practices became more complex with the rise of computerized accounting systems and sophisticated financial instruments, the nature of accounting tests for employment shifted. The demand for candidates with advanced analytical, problem-solving, and technology skills became paramount. The historical evolution of accounting tests for employment reflects a parallel evolution in accounting itself, mirroring the industry's technological advances and changing professional requirements.

3. Types of Accounting Tests for Employment



The types of accounting tests for employment available vary considerably. Some tests focus on specific accounting concepts, while others assess a broader range of skills. Common test formats include:

Multiple-choice questions: These tests assess knowledge of accounting principles and procedures.
Problem-solving questions: These tests require candidates to apply accounting principles to solve practical problems.
Simulations: These tests simulate real-world accounting scenarios, allowing recruiters to assess candidates' ability to apply their skills in a practical setting.
Computerized accounting tests: These tests evaluate proficiency in using specific accounting software packages.
Behavioral assessments: These tests assess personality traits and work habits that are important for success in accounting roles.


4. The Importance of Validity and Reliability in Accounting Tests for Employment



The effectiveness of accounting tests for employment hinges on their validity and reliability. A valid test accurately measures what it intends to measure – a candidate’s accounting capabilities. A reliable test consistently produces similar results over time and across different administrations. Ensuring both validity and reliability is crucial to avoid bias and ensure fair assessment of candidates. This requires careful test design, rigorous validation processes, and regular updates to reflect evolving industry practices. The use of standardized, well-validated accounting tests for employment helps organizations minimize the risk of hiring unqualified candidates.

6. The Future of Accounting Tests for Employment



The future of accounting tests for employment is likely to be shaped by technological advancements and evolving industry demands. We can expect to see a greater emphasis on tests that assess digital literacy, data analytics skills, and the ability to utilize emerging technologies such as AI and blockchain in accounting. Furthermore, adaptive testing technologies, which adjust the difficulty of questions based on a candidate's performance, are likely to become more prevalent. This will allow for more precise assessments of individual candidate abilities.
